Durability
A sofa is an important investment, and you'll want to keep looking good and comfortable. This is why you should think about how your sofa will last and wear over time. If you're looking for an item that will last longer, leather is the better choice than fabric.
Leather is a natural material that is tough and resistant to staining. It is also easy to clean, so should you spill a drink or eat something, all you need to do is clean it with a cloth. If you do choose to purchase leather furniture, many manufacturers offer a kit of care (usually an apron and cream) that can help improve the condition of the leather and prolong its lifespan.
Unlike fabric, leather also does not absorb moisture as well, which means it stays dry for a longer period. This can reduce the chance of forming marks and creases, as the surface is more able to dry. This is particularly beneficial if your children or pets prefer to lounge on your sofa.
Another benefit of leather is that it's hypoallergenic. This is ideal in the event that you or family members suffer from allergies or asthma. Fabric sofas often trap dust hair and mites, which can cause reactions in those who have sensitive respiratory systems. If you choose a leather sofa, this will prevent these allergens from settling into the fibres and triggering symptoms.

Care
A leather sofa is an investment that lasts a lifetime and requires regular maintenance. Regular conditioning using a specific leather protection cream ensures that the material is robust and healthy. It also helps to minimise color transfer, faded dye and abrasion damage caused by regular use. Certain semi-aniline hides develop natural markings over time and gradually develop a "lived-in" appearance. This is part of their appeal and adds to the look of a sofa.
Follow the directions of the manufacturer and test the cleaning products on a small area before applying them to your sofa. Clean up spills as quickly as possible. Grease and oil stainings are difficult to get rid of. Regularly wipe your sofa with a damp rag. Be particular about the seams, creases, and buttons of the Chesterfield.
